Constructing a computerized test in biology For the third intermediate  grade according to The two-parameter model

Abstract

The aim of the current study is to “construct a computerized question bank for biology for the third intermediate grade according to the two parameter model.” To achieve this goal, the researcher analyzed the content of all biology chapters for the third intermediate grade according to the theory of latent traits. Then, the researcher presented the behavioral objectives, test items and alternatives to a group of experts and arbitrators to ensure the availability of appropriate characteristics for them and their alternatives in terms of form and content. The researcher took the modifications proposed by experts (biology teachers) and arbitrators (in the field of measurement, evaluation and educational psychology). All test items and their behavioral objectives reached to (402) test items for the 14 biology chapters.

The researcher computerized the question bank by programmer engineers, then the researcher applied the test to the third intermediate grade students in the schools affiliated to the province of Babylon on a sample of (1000) male and female students who were chosen by the simple random method, and the researcher used the (STATA) program to analyze the test items. To verify the hypotheses of the model, the researcher followed the following:

First: One-dimensionality: To verify this hypothesis, the researcher conducted a factorial analysis of the test using the Kaiser variable maximization method (Varimax), so he produced one general factor in each test whose values ​​were greater than (1) and the proportions of the explained variance for each of them. The same factor on the lower limits of (Getman), which the factor is statistically significant when the potential root that can be interpreted is equal to or greater than (1), and (30.0) and above were adopted as the percentage of saturation of the test items with the general factor according to the criterion ( Gilford), and through the results of the factor analysis, no item of the test was excluded, and thus the test consisted of (154) test items.

Second: Test of good fit: the data for the complete sample of (1000) individuals were analyzed and (154) test items were analyzed for the computerized question bank tests

Third: Measurement independence: By achieving the independence of measurement, , where the test consists of (140) test items in its final form.

  • The (difficulty, standard error, and ability) were transferred from the logit unit to the manf unit, where the manf unit is equal to (5 * logit + 50).
  • The cut-off score was determined for the computerized question bank consisting of five tests, comprising (140) test items, using the Angof method.

Fourth: Signs of validity and reliability: The validity of the test was verified through descriptive validity (the opinions of experts and arbitrators at all stages of preparing the computerized question bank) and functional honesty through indicators of appropriateness of item to the model used, as the statistics of Kai (Ka2) were used to judge the appropriateness of the items, and the discrimination coefficient was calculated. It is considered one of the indicators of construction validity, as well as extracting the factor analysis and the correlation of the paragraph with the total score, which measures the concept.

The internal consistency stability coefficient of the scale items, in its final form consisting of (140) items, was calculated using the Cronbach’s alpha-Cronbach equation, and it reached (0.83), using the Statistical Package Program (SPSS), and it indicates that the computerized question bank has an acceptable degree of reliability.

   key words : Test- Computerized Test- The two-parameter model
